Job Description:
We are seeking a dedicated and detail-oriented Senior Services Concierge to join our growing team. As a Services Concierge consultant, you will have a deep understanding of both the sales pursuit and implementation processes and play a pivotal role in ensuring new customers are prepared for project kick off, providing guidance on pre-kickoff activities, orientation to key implementation resources, and acting as a point of contact if customers have questions before the project starts. You will serve as a dedicated UKG representative, setting our customers up for a successful implementation through webinars, readiness assessments, and proactive risk mitigation in tight partnership with the sales, presales, and services teams.
Responsibilities:
• Conduct readiness assessments with customers to determine level of care and assistance needed during pre-kickoff phases.
• Host pre-kickoff virtual events to welcome new customers and orient them to what will happen next.
• Act as subject matter expert on services methodology, timelines, and customer expectations to guide customers and set appropriate expectations ahead of PM assignment.
• Coordinate with internal teams to ensure customer questions are answered in a timely manner and to share learnings from pre-kickoff engagements with Services Concierge team.
• Direct customer to content and enablement resources to use for training/education and to help accelerate product adoption.
• Proactively conduct short learning bursts that cover the early needs of the customer including: onboarding expectations, high-level overview of the product/ demonstration of products purchased, and ancillary items like the invoicing/billing process.
• Guide customers on pre-project prep activities such as gathering import templates for common integrations, setting up their project team and internal meeting cadence, and sharing best practices for a successful implementation.
• Work across Sales, RNT, and Services to ensure customer expectations are set and met, mitigating potential implementation risks and triaging escalation points around scoping, product fit, project timeline, billing, and contract concerns.

Qualifications:

• Bachelor's degree in business administration, Marketing, Sales, or related experience
• 2-4+ years of experience in a customer facing role working with technical products, ideally in presales or consulting / implementation
• B2B SaaS experience with a technical product and CRM tools (i.e. Salesforce)
• Proven project management skills and experience working with multiple customers concurrently
• Excellent oral and written communication skills
• Experience speaking to customers representing different personas across both function and seniority
• Passion for delivering exceptional customer service
• UKG experience a plus
-Willingness to work Pacific and/or Mountain time zone hours
